A GTK+ / GStreamer based music player
Go to file
Anna Schumaker 5964c508ce core/playlists/artists: Load each playlist with a different idle task
This seems less efficient overall, since we now need to take several
passes over the track database.  What I've noticed is that the
single-pass option creates a lot of UI notifications that makes the gui
unresponsive for a large amount of time.  Breaking this into smaller
chunks gives us a chance to handle any user actions between loading each
playlist.

Fixes #71: Initalize artist playlists with more idle tasks
Signed-off-by: Anna Schumaker <Anna@NoWheyCreamery.com>
2016-08-13 09:50:24 -04:00
core core/playlists/artists: Load each playlist with a different idle task 2016-08-13 09:50:24 -04:00
gui core/collection: Remove file 2016-08-13 08:31:30 -04:00
include core/collection: Remove file 2016-08-13 08:31:30 -04:00
share gui: UI spacing improvements 2016-08-13 09:49:21 -04:00
tests core/collection: Remove file 2016-08-13 08:31:30 -04:00
.gitattributes Ocarina 6.3 2015-01-16 13:05:43 -05:00
.gitignore Remove Doxygen tags 2015-09-02 14:24:42 -04:00
.gitlab-ci.yml Set gitlab-ci stages on one line 2016-02-26 14:31:12 -05:00
CHANGELOG core/playlists/artists: Load each playlist with a different idle task 2016-08-13 09:50:24 -04:00
LICENSE Update the license 2014-04-06 19:57:06 -04:00
PKGBUILD Ocarina 6.4.17 2016-08-13 08:27:55 -04:00
README Add git protocol entry to the README 2016-02-23 11:27:04 -05:00
Sconstruct Ocarina 6.4.18-rc 2016-08-13 09:07:26 -04:00
TODO Ocarina 6.4.15-rc 2016-06-24 11:13:55 -04:00

README

Alternate clone url:
	$ git clone git://git.ocarinaproject.net/anna/ocarina.git

Build:
	$ scons

Clean:
	$ scons -c

Install:
	$ sudo scons install

Uninstall:
	$ sudo scons -c install

Build tests:
	$ scons tests

Clean tests:
	$ scons -c tests